I know there is a way to use IDV to convert NetCDF files to Excel > files, however I cannot seem to find the tool I was shown to do this. I am > working with an Excel Water Balance Model, and need to convert the precip > and temp NARCCAP data into Excel format in order to input them into the > model. I am running IDV 5.0u2 on a MacBook Pro version 10.10.2. I also have > a desktop PC for when things can't be run on the Mac. I would attach one of > my precip files, however even the compressed file is too large to send via > email. > > Thank you, > Rebecca Boyd Rebecca, You load the dataset from the Dashboard > Data Chooser, under the Field Selector, you can select Formulas > Export > Export Grid to Excel, in the Displays, you can select any type, such as Plan Views > Contour Plan View, you will see a popup window for entering the excel file name, and so on....
